UNCASVILLE, Conn. (AP) – A man wanted in the weekend armed robbery of a Rhode Island bank was apprehended a few hours later while playing cards at the Mohegan Sun casino.

Vincent Rampone, 52, of Cranston, R.I., was spotted at a blackjack table just before 8 p.m. Saturday by casino security workers who had been given photos of the suspect, state police said.

Rampone was wanted in the armed robbery of a Cranston bank around 10:30 a.m. Saturday. Authorities said he was carrying about $1,400 that had serial numbers that matched the stolen cash.

State police said Rampone confessed to the crime after his arrest. He’s being held on a $200,000 bond on fugitive and narcotics charges and is due in court on Monday.
